NIL token ($NIL) is the native token of the Nillion network, and Nillion is a decentralized public computing network based on a new cryptographic primitive - Nil Message Compute (NMC). Unlike traditional blockchains, Nillion does not rely on an immutable ledger, but provides a solution for secure storage and computation of high-value data through a non-blockchain architecture. Its goal is to create a privacy-protecting computing infrastructure for scenarios such as artificial intelligence (AI), Internet of Things (IoT), and data markets.

The core of Blind Computation
The core technology of Nillion is blind computation, which uses Information-Theoretic Security to allow data to be computed in an encrypted state without decryption. This technology is more efficient than traditional Secure Multi-Party Computation (SMPC) because nodes do not need to communicate directly. The NIL token is used to pay for the network fees of blind computation, ensuring data privacy while supporting complex operations.
Innovation without blockchain architecture
Unlike the blockchain design of Ethereum or Bitcoin, Nillion achieves trust distribution through a distributed node cluster, reducing costs and enhancing privacy protection capabilities. $NIL is used in the Coordination Layer for settlement service fees to drive efficient network operation.

Comparison with competitors
The difference between Phala Network and Nillion: Phala relies on Trusted Execution Environment (TEE), while Nillion’s blind computation is more efficient and does not require hardware trust assumptions.
Relationship with EigenLayer: EigenLayer focuses on Ethereum re-staking, while Nillion’s non-blockchain design is more suitable for cross-chain privacy computing.
